Barys Zhaliba: Lukashenka Gives Carbon-Copy Orders To Government
BARYS ZHALIBA

The Belarusian ruler does not intend to save the country's economy.

Doctor of Economic Sciences Barys Zhaliba says in the commentary to Salidarnasts how to save the country's economy and why it will not be done.

On September 4th, the dictator held a meeting with the government on "topical issues of economic development".

- It is clear to everyone that the elaboration of plans for the "country's future development" takes place in the last months, in the fourth quarter of any year. First of all, it is the planning for next year. It is about the production, and in general, the whole of our life. I have repeatedly said that this year and next year are special years - the years of "parliamentary" and "presidential elections". We are passing an exam. That's why we have to tighten up everywhere," - the press service quotes Aliaksandr Lukashenka.

The main tasks and challenges faced by the authorities are diversification of sales markets and high dependence on the supply of products to Russia.

Barys Zhaliba shared his opinion on what exactly should be planned for the next year to improve the economic situation in the country.

- Recipes have been known for a long time. Earlier, our main creditors - the IMF, the World Bank - drew up an activities plan for Belarus. Now it is at the second stage, when the representatives of the World Bank are working with our government, specifying its provisions, - the expert said.

First of all, we are talking about reforming the public sector. But according to the economist, the government has not even started to deal with this issue yet.

- It is already known what exactly should be done with the enterprises belonging to the public sector. If it is not the overall privatization, then, as a minimum, they are divided into three main groups: the first group - companies that can operate independently, the second group - companies that need state support, the third one - companies that should be simply closed down. This is not the first year that we have been talking about it, but it all ends with these talks," - the expert stressed.

According to him, as long as the majority of state-owned enterprises live in debt, giving up to a half of their revenue to creditors, there is no point in talking about any investments:

- As for the diversification of sales markets, the optimal formula is known here as well: one third of the export volume to the markets of Russia, one third of it - to the EU, and one third - to the countries of the distant arc. But as before, Russia accounts for about 50% of our trade turnover, and the share of the European Union has even decreased.

According to Barys Zhaliba, the ruler did not show anything new in the distribution of tasks to the government:

- Everything is being done as if it were carbon copied. It is not the government's fault. The government can act only with the permission of Lukashenka. And the government does not have such a permission (to carry out reforms). And it operates within the limits that do not allow it to push the GDP in the direction of further growth.
